Unitized connector arrangement for electrical apparatus
First Claim
1. A connector arrangement for an electronic apparatus having means for receiving an inserted electronic device, the arrangement comprising in combination:
- an arm member rotatably mounted and biased into a first position in the apparatus and including contact means, positioning means for positioning the inserted device relative to the contact means, and first and second shoulder portions, the first shoulder portion engaging a projecting portion of the inserted device, as the device is inserted, for causing rotation of the arm member into a second position, said rotation bringing the positioning means and, subsequently, the contact means into engagement with mating contact portions of the inserted device;
enabling means having a first position for preventing rotation of the arm member, and movable by insertion of the electronic device to a second position wherein the arm member is able to rotate, the enabling means being biased into said first position; and
latching means having a projecting portion for engaging the second shoulder portion of the arm member for releasably retaining the arm member in the second position.

Abstract
A connecting and latching mechanism in an electronic apparatus is activated by a portion of the housing of a complementary electronic device as it is inserted for interconnection and charging. Varying sizes of devices can be accommodated. Three rotatable elements, two pawls and a connector arm, are mounted on a single base plate. One pawl keeps the connector arm from being damaged before device insertion and helps position the device upon insertion. A connector block on the connector arm is rotated into position for contacting the terminals of the device by a second portion of the device housing. When the connector block is in full contact with the terminals, the connector arm is latched by another pawl. A lock must be deactivated by key or manually operated button to release the latching pawl, the connector arm and the inserted device. Rotatable charging contacts provide scouring motion at the contact points and also accommodate devices of varying lengths.

8. A connector arrangement for an electronic apparatus having means for receiving an inserted electronic device, the arrangement comprising in combination:
-
first contact means for connecting operating circuitry of the inserted device to operating circuitry of the apparatus, the contact means providing a locking function for the device within the apparatus; second contact means for connecting charging circuitry of the inserted device to a corresponding charging current source in the apparatus; and means for biasing an inserted device against an inner portion of the apparatus. - View Dependent Claims (9, 10, 11)

12. A connector arrangement for an electronic apparatus having means for receiving an inserted electronic device, the arrangement comprising in combination:
contact means rotatably mounted within the apparatus in the path of the device for mating with contact means on the first inserted surface of the inserted device, the contact means of the apparatus being biased into a position substantially perpendicular to the contact means of the device, as the device is being inserted and the inward movement of the device contacts against the apparatus contacts causing rotation of the apparatus contact means for causing scraping motion by the apparatus contacts on the device contacts.
